Output 6e79c2fdde4de8c09de30f82747f7f21e66b028b61191c32f5073938a23c5b4e:14

value
2526518
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c1ac908d30e23b250154e14fb956fd03a8095c65 OP_EQUAL
address
3KM54ZykgwRzdxHZ48Fyqq5myVXjVfYdXj
transaction
6e79c2fdde4de8c09de30f82747f7f21e66b028b61191c32f5073938a23c5b4e
confirmations
267158
spent
true